Is 438 835 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 438 835 is about 662.446.

Thus, the square root of 438 835 is not an integer, and therefore 438 835 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 438 835?

The square of a number (here 438 835) is the result of the product of this number (438 835) by itself (i.e., 438 835 × 438 835); the square of 438 835 is sometimes called "raising 438 835 to the power 2", or "438 835 squared".

The square of 438 835 is 192 576 157 225 because 438 835 × 438 835 = 438 8352 = 192 576 157 225.

As a consequence, 438 835 is the square root of 192 576 157 225.
